#141ff8 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#141ff8 is composed of 7.8% red, 12.2% green and 97.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 91.9% cyan, 87.5% magenta, 0% yellow and 2.7% black. It has a hue angle of 237.1 degrees, a saturation of 94.2% and a lightness of 52.5%. #141ff8 color hex could be obtained by blending #283eff with #0000f1. Closest websafe color is: #0033ff.

Shades and Tints of #141ff8

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#00010d is the darkest color, while #f9f9ff is the lightest one.

Tones of #141ff8

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#848488 is the less saturated color, while #141ff8 is the most saturated one.

Color Blindness Simulator

Below, you can see how #141ff8 is perceived by people affected by a color vision deficiency. This can be useful if you need to ensure your color combinations are accessible to color-blind users.

Monochromacy
  • #343434 Achromatopsia 0.005% of the population
  • #2e305b Atypical Achromatopsia 0.001% of the population
Dichromacy
  • #0056a6 Protanopia 1% of men
  • #005b8f Deuteranopia 1% of men
  • #006165 Tritanopia 0.001% of the population
Trichromacy
  • #0742c4 Protanomaly 1% of men, 0.01% of women
  • #0745b5 Deuteranomaly 6% of men, 0.4% of women
  • #07499a Tritanomaly 0.01% of the population
